Episode Description
In this episode, Fahad Al Riyami talks about his company AeroVecto, an Oman-based startup developing a high-capacity hybrid eVTOL aircraft designed to transform urban mobility across the Middle East and beyond.
Fahad shares the inspiration behind the company, its vision to create scalable shuttle networks that ease congestion in high-density cities, and how their 18-passenger hybrid design sets them apart from other players in the space. He also discusses the challenges of autonomy, infrastructure, and public acceptance, as well as how Oman and the wider region are positioning themselves as leaders in advanced air mobility.
From his personal journey and passion for aviation to AeroVecto’s roadmap toward commercial deployment, this episode offers a fascinating look at one of the Middle East’s most ambitious eVTOL ventures.
